A New York Times’ story on Sen. Marco Rubio billed as an investigative piece backfired a bit after readers reacted to the big reveal – that the presidential candidate and his wife have had traffic tickets over the years – by donating more to the Floridian’s campaign.
The story, entitled “Rubios on the Road Have Drawn Unwanted Attention,” shows how Rubio has received four traffic tickets in 18 years – and his wife, 13 tickets since 1997. Mediaite mocked the report with a single word: “Rutt-Row.”
Even the Washington Post asked the New York Post’s media columnist for explanation about the investigative piece and received an email in reply: “The vote for president is the most personal vote that Americans cast. Voters want to know about these candidates – not just as policy-makers, but as people. It is not at all unusual or unexpected for us to scrutinize candidates’ backgrounds and their lives through public records. It is very standard scrubbing.”
But the assigning of two reporters to the story, Alan Rappeport and Steve Eder, is unusual, as is the scrutiny of Rubio’s wife, Mediaite reported. Moreover, the same newspaper failed to give President Obama similar treatment in 2007, when it went seemingly unnoticed – or at least unreported – by the media outlet he had 15 outstanding parking tickets in 2007 that spanned all the way back to the 1980s.
Rubio’s presidential campaign is using the report for fundraising via the hashtag #RubioCrimeSpree. The hashtag quickly moved into Twitter’s top trending spot, leading many political analysts to predict a sure rise in fundraising revenues for the candidate.
One Twitter user wrote: “#RubioCrimeSpree Once went through Publix express checkout lane with 11 items.”
Another: “Ordered an EggMcMuffin at 11:03 am #RubioCrimeSpree.”
Another: “If @marcorubio was a Dem, the @nytimes story on his driving would have speculated he was a victim of racial profiling. #RubioCrimeSpree.”
